BREAKING: Muazu Resigns As PDP National Chairman

Posted by admin | 9 years ago | 2,851 times



Reports reaching us indicate that the national chairman of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), Adamu Mu’azu has resigned as chairman.
This comes after several bigwigs of the party blamed him for Jonathan’s defeat at the poll and demanded his resignation.
In a report published by This day, his resignation took effect immediately.
Reports also indicate that President Goodluck Jonathan has asked the chairman of PDP Board of Trustees (BoT), Chief Anthony Anenih to resign his office as the BOT chairman.

However, it’s still yet to be ascertained if Anenih has accepted to resign or not.
